Bug#316216: mozilla-firefox: opening up more than 16 tabs causes intermittent failure to access sites

2005-06-29 Thread Luke Kenneth Casson Leighton
Package: mozilla-firefox
Version: 1.0.1-1
Severity: normal


as subject line says.

i always always always always open up new tabs due to that
irritating bug which has been present in firefox for well
over three years and has never been satisfactorily resolved
(as best i can determine) - the one where keyboard focus is
"lagged" onto another mozilla window behind the one you're
actually using (and if you select another mozilla window,
the keyboard focus jumps to the window you WERE using, repeat,
repeat.  solution: open up in tabs.  always)

what i am finding is that intermittently, after four to six
hours of constant use of mozilla, or after several hours use
followed by say an overnight break followed by returning to
mozilla (without exiting) that all of a sudden opening links
in new tabs, the tabs are unresponsive as if there was no
internet connection.

exiting mozilla and re-running it of course "solves" the problem.
